Delicious fruity frozen treats!


Chocolate coated strawberries & Chocolate coated banana with a little peanut butter

To me there's nothing better than having frozen fruit on a hot summers day, of course Ice cream is great! But at least with these it's a little healthier. They're so simple and quick to make. 

You can use any fruits you like but I went with strawberries and banana's. It's strange because I don't like strawberries but I love them frozen and espcially covered in chocolate! 

I used two types of chocolate. For the strawberries I used Galaxy and for the banana's I used cooking chocolate. 

Chop up your banana's and place them on a sheet of greese proof paper. I didn't put peanut butter in all of mine because some people in my family don't like peanut butter, very weird! (not that I'm calling you weird if you don't like peanut butter... ) But if you do choose to use peanut butter just spread as much as you want on top of the banana. Melt your chocolate and literally just either dip your fruit in the heavinly chocolate bowl or use a spoon to pour the chocolate on top of the fruit. 
Then leave them to freeze over night, and while your sleeping you'll be dreaming of those tasty treats you'll be having the next day!
